DIR, ALUMNI & DEVELOPMENT RECORDS
Job Title: DIR, ALUMNI & DEVELOPMENT RECORDS
Job Code: 1140
FLSA: E
Job Level: 16
Revised Date: 11/01/2013
Job Family: JF 28
Occupational Summary
Direct and coordinate the maintenance of gift records involving the receipt, processing and acknowledgement of gifts to Duke University from private sources; serve as Major Gifts Officer in a major fundraising project.
Work Performed
Direct and supervise the receiving, processing and acknowledgement of all private gifts to the University which includes cash, securities and gift in kind of value.
Manage a timely system of gift acknowledgment, including the mailing of receipts, the advising of appropriate University officials and reporting to donors for memorials and similar projects.
Manage and coordinate all aspects of gift accounting; maintain liaison with appropriate University departments to ensure proper recording of gifts; analyze existing office gift processing and accounting procedures and implement improved methods as necessary.
Maintain regular communication with various University departmental representatives to advise of the receipt of gifts and to ensure proper distribution of specific gifts.
Evaluate, propose and implement methods and activities to improve donor relations, improve the collection of funds and increase revenues to Duke.
Meet with donors to accept gifts, answer questions about gift designations, and provide information about pledges and previous gifts; interpret donor desires and mediate to meet University interests.
Identify, cultivate and solicit individuals, corporations and foundations for major gifts to Duke University; supervise special fundraising projects as assigned.
Assist Director, Development Support Services in the establishment of long term directions for the Gift Records office and the gift system.
Prepare special reports and analyses setting forth progress, adverse trends and appropriate recommendations or conclusions; direct the preparation of a variety of reports for Officers of the University.
Determine fiscal requirements for office and prepare budgetary recommendations; monitor, verify and reconcile expenditure of budgeted funds.
Recommend various personnel actions including, but not limited to, hiring, performance appraisals, promotions, transfers and vacation schedules.
Perform other related duties incidental to the work described herein.
